Nevada Highway Patrol (NHP) says I-80 west has been reopened after it was shut down at mile marker 105 in Lovelock due to a semi-truck rollover crash.

Drivers were being diverted at the 106.

The crash was first reported just after 6 a.m. Tuesday. 

NHP says no one was hurt. 

There's no immediate word on what caused the crash, but they do say there was spilled fuel across the roadway.

The roads were closed for almost nine hours for the clean up.
